Oily Skin
If you’re having trouble with oily skin, try to incorporate moisturizer into your daily routine. Use it after washing the face and before applying your makeup. While you may feel that it isn’t necessary, it actually aids in balancing the skin’s oil production. If you have oily skin and then you dry the skin out with very harsh cleanser, you will make matters worse.
A lot of body washes can contribute to drying out your skin more than the environmental factors. If you don’t want to have dry skin, you need to select a body wash that has natural vitamins and moisturizers. These ingredients will help keep moisture in, and will also help your skin regenerate.
If you’re dealing with oily skin, try to get a foundation that contains no oil or try a mineral powder. Foundations such as these are made to eliminate your skin’s excess oils. If your skin tends to be more oily, it is best to avoid liquid foundations, since they tend to make the skin worse.
